Output 103e1aa81d51a142c16ce37c30ec018d343a1af607e685959e368b3e23e2550f:0

value
11606
script pubkey
OP_0 OP_PUSHBYTES_20 e67b1bb63474d2a808e9f5384fc037c88cad6bc6
address
bc1quea3hd35wnf2sz8f75uylsphezx2667xpuk8ml
transaction
103e1aa81d51a142c16ce37c30ec018d343a1af607e685959e368b3e23e2550f